Habit for aiming at Mango turns gold for archer Deepika

Sun, Oct 10 10 07:57 PM

Ranchi, Oct 10 (PTI) Little did Deepika Kumari''s mother know that her daughter''s penchant for aiming at the mangoes hanging in the trees would one day fetch her gold and glory in archery. Jharkhand Chief Minister Arjun Munda has announced Rs 10 lakh cash award for Deepika''s individual twin gold medal feat. Thrilled at Deepika''s success in the Commonwealth Games, parents Gita and Shiv Charan Mahato said she would hurl stones at the hanging mangoes. "Right from her school days, Deepika is fond of target practising, and used to hurl stones at mangoes," her mother Gita said. "Today, we are very happy for her contribution in the team event at the Games," she told reporters. Reigning cadet world champion and World Cup Stage 4 silver medallist, Deepika won the women''s recurve individual and team gold medals at the archery competition of the Games. It was in Munda''s Arjun Archery Academy at Sareikela-Kharsawan where Deepika started her career in 2005 before moving to Tata Archery Academy (TAA). Munda congratulated Deepika and wished her all the best for her next individual event.
